Global Smart Buildings Market Size, Share and Outlook - Growth Analysis Report and Forecast Trends 2026-2030

The global smart buildings market encompasses integrated systems that use sensors, software, and connectivity to optimize building performance, energy efficiency, and occupant comfort. Valued at approximately $134 billion in 2025, the market is projected to expand rapidly with a compound annual growth rate of around 21%. This growth is driven by the convergence of artificial intelligence, IoT technologies, and increasing regulatory pressure to reduce carbon emissions. The sector covers residential, commercial, and industrial buildings adopting building automation, energy management, and security systems.

Market Overview

Smart buildings integrate advanced technologies including building automation systems, energy management platforms, and security infrastructure to automate and optimize operations. The market spans solutions for lighting, HVAC, access control, water management, and predictive maintenance across residential, commercial, and industrial segments. Growth is fueled by urbanization, sustainability mandates, and the falling cost of IoT sensors and connectivity hardware.

  • Building automation systems represent the largest solution segment, covering HVAC, lighting, and elevator controls
  • Energy management systems account for a significant share as operators seek to cut utility costs and carbon footprints
  • The market includes both hardware, such as sensors and controllers, and software including analytics platforms and management dashboards

Growth Drivers

Energy efficiency regulations and carbon reduction targets are compelling building owners to modernize infrastructure with connected systems. The deployment of 5G networks and edge computing has reduced latency for real-time building management applications. Additionally, the post-pandemic emphasis on healthy indoor air quality and touchless access has accelerated adoption of smart ventilation and security systems.

  • Government mandates for net-zero buildings and energy codes are pushing retrofits and new construction toward smart systems
  • Artificial intelligence and machine learning enable predictive maintenance, reducing operational costs and unplanned downtime
  • Rising energy prices make the return on investment of smart energy management increasingly attractive to facility managers

Segmentation and Regional Analysis

The market is segmented by component into solutions, such as building automation, energy management, and security systems, and services including installation, maintenance, and consulting. Geographically, North America and Europe lead in adoption due to stringent building codes and high retrofit activity, while Asia-Pacific is the fastest-growing region driven by new construction and smart city initiatives. The Middle East and Latin America represent emerging markets with growing investment in sustainable infrastructure.

  • Commercial buildings constitute the largest end-use segment, followed by residential and industrial facilities
  • Building infrastructure management, including smart water and parking systems, is a rapidly expanding sub-segment
  • Smart city programs across multiple regions are creating substantial demand for integrated building platforms

Trends and Outlook

What are the recent trends and outlook?

The integration of artificial intelligence with building management systems is enabling autonomous optimization of energy use, space utilization, and predictive maintenance. Digital twins and advanced analytics are becoming standard tools for facility operators to simulate and improve building performance. As sustainability reporting requirements tighten globally, smart building data is increasingly critical for compliance and corporate ESG disclosures.

  • AI-driven predictive maintenance is reducing equipment failures and extending asset lifespans across building systems
  • Convergence with smart grid and renewable energy technologies is creating fully integrated energy ecosystems
  • Cybersecurity and data privacy are emerging as critical priorities as buildings become more connected
